Private Shuttle Services for Hospital Staff
Many healthcare workers in Flint live far from their workplaces or work irregular shifts that don’t align with public transit schedules. Providing a private shuttle service is an effective way to help your staff commute safely and comfortably while reducing stress and absenteeism. You can design custom routes that pick up employees near their homes or park-and-ride lots in Genesee County, drop them off directly at the hospital entrance, and return them after their shift ends. This not only saves time and money but also improves morale and retention among your workforce.
Onboard amenities like reclining seats, climate control, and free WiFi allow passengers to relax or catch up on work during the ride. For added convenience, you can offer multiple departure times to accommodate different shift schedules—especially important for nurses, doctors, and support staff who work overnight or extended hours. If your facility has limited parking, shuttles can also help alleviate congestion by transporting employees from remote lots or satellite locations.

Patient and Visitor Shuttles
Large hospital campuses like Hurley Medical Center and McLaren Flint often have sprawling layouts with multiple buildings, parking structures, and entrances. Navigating these complexes can be overwhelming for patients and visitors—especially those with limited mobility or unfamiliar with the area. A dedicated shuttle service helps bridge the gap by providing frequent, convenient rides between key points on campus.
Whether it’s transporting someone from a distant parking lot to the main lobby or shuttling guests between different departments, our buses offer a safe and accessible solution. Clear signage, audio announcements, and friendly drivers make it easy for riders to find their way. During peak visiting hours or special events, additional shuttles can be added to accommodate higher demand.
